Cellula and ENI team up to bring Proof-of-Work mining to Web3 games

3 weeks ago 4 Min Read

Cellula, a leader in decentralized gaming, has entered into an innovative partnership with ENI Chain. This partnership creates new ways for miners on the ENI blockchain to be rewarded for their work, and could fundamentally change the way players interact with blockchain-based games in the future.

Bringing the proof-of-work spirit to Web3 games

Cellula is integrating ENI’s blockchain infrastructure to bring what they call the “spirit and mechanics of PoW” to gaming environments. This partnership involves a combination of traditional Proof of Work ideas and modern gameplay, namely mining efforts on BitLife and the ENI chain, and the creation of new incentive models for players.

This move is part of a larger trend in Web3 gaming, with projects turning to more advanced blockchain foundations to build greater utility and engagement. Similar to recent synergistic vehicles that combine lifestyle activities and rewards, Cellula’s strategy marks a departure from simple token-driven models.

Advantages of ENI’s technology infrastructure

ENI Chain provides significant technical capabilities to the partnership, which is purpose-built to deliver large-scale commercial applications. Supporting up to 10,000 transactions per second and highly parallel computing, it can deliver high throughput even when demand is high. Its infrastructure is based on a three-layer EPoS consensus model that combines vRF, Elturbobft, and another consensus layer used for performance, security, and reliability.

Developers can create flexible applications in the Web3 ecosystem using a modular design that removes the limitations imposed by monolithic blockchains. Modular blockchain architecture and the AppChain framework have helped developers create these types of applications. Modular design is widely seen as the future of scalable blockchain infrastructure development.

For Cellula, this means real benefits in managing massive amounts of player activity, supporting complex in-game economies, and delivering fast, responsive gameplay. Transaction-intensive gaming environments require high TPS capacity to provide a smooth user experience.

Strategic implications of blockchain gaming

This collaboration represents a far-reaching shift in the approach blockchain gaming projects take when choosing infrastructure. The development community is trending towards more specific solutions that can support specific use cases, rather than using generic chains or starting single projects. Using PoW-inspired mining mechanics in gaming environments can help enable new types of player engagement models, where players’ computational contributions are rewarded in addition to traditional gameplay achievements.

This collaboration is indicative of the overall development of the blockchain gaming industry and how technological savvy has become as important as gameplay innovation. The project has moved beyond the initial hype stage and is starting to focus on characters with strong technical foundations and a sustainable ecosystem. The focus on flexible, modular architecture shows that Cellula is thinking long-term in terms of scalability and adaptability.

conclusion

The gaming industry plans to closely monitor Cellula and ENI’s use of these tools and resources and use many of the results as a template for how to use specialized infrastructure in future blockchain gaming projects. Many projects will take these lessons and leverage them to build new partnerships within the global Web3 gaming ecosystem. This collaboration is another major step forward in the continued evolution of blockchain gaming towards large-scale and sustainable acceptance.
